RECOGNIZING BRIAN DILLON
______
HON. GUS M. BILIRAKIS
of florida
in the house of representatives
Friday, February 21, 2025
Mr. BILIRAKIS. Mr. Speaker, I rise today to honor and recognize the
exceptional dedication and hard work of one of my outstanding
constituents, Brian Dillon.
Brian has recently completed an internship in the Office of the Clerk
for the House of Representatives, where he has been an invaluable
asset, assisting with a wide range of matters that have come before
him. This opportunity came after Brian made the remarkable decision to
graduate from high school early, demonstrating not only his drive but
his commitment to public service. With a deep sense of purpose, he
traveled all the way from Florida to Washington, D.C., to contribute to
the work of our government and lend a helping hand to the people of
Florida and the United States.
Throughout his time here, Brian has played a role in supporting the
office with various tasks, including assisting staff with vacant
offices, processing administrative paperwork, and assisting with other
legislative duties. His dedication and tireless work ethic have not
gone unnoticed, and he has made an impact during his time with the
House.
As Brian's internship draws to a close, he plans to return to
Florida, where he will embark on a new chapter of his career as an
electrician apprentice. I have no doubt that his future is bright, and
I wish him the very best of luck as he takes this important step toward
a successful career.
It is young individuals like Brian who inspire all of us with their
initiative, hard work, and commitment to their communities. I am proud
to have him represent the great state of Florida, and I look forward to
seeing the great things he will undoubtedly achieve in the years to
come.
